Baked Salmon with Herbs is a perfect dish for a quick and easy dinner at home or when you want to impress your guests with minimal effort.

Obviously, salmon fillets are the essential part of this recipe. You should marinate the fillets with a mixture of olive oil, lemon juice, garlic, and a blend of dried herbs like thyme and rosemary to make each bite tastier and softer. Keep in mind that as the marination process takes longer, better the salmon will taste.

Once the salmon has marinaded, put it on a baking sheet and slide it into a preheated oven to 200 °C. Just around 15 minutes, your kitchen will be filled with the delightful smell of perfectly baked salmon. Also you can prepare your favorite side dishes to accompany it while the salmon is baking away in the oven. Whether you’re in the mood for some roasted veggies, green salad, or perhaps some buttery mashed potatoes. The choice of how to color your plate is yours!

Here is a couple of important tips to ensure your baked salmon turns out just right. Most importantly, as cooking time may differ depending on your oven and thickness of the fillets, you should watch out for time. Because salmon fillets should be cooked through but stay tender and moist. Furthermore, don’t rush the marination process. Let those flavors mix for at least 20 minutes, or even longer if you have the time.

Roasted Salmon with Herbs Recipe

Serves: 4 Prep Time: Cooking Time:
Nutrition facts: 400 calories 9 grams fat

Ingredients

  • 4 Salmon fillets
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
  • 3 coves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on dried thyme
  • 1 teaspoon dried rosemary
  • 2 teaspoon salt

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 200 °C (400 °F)
  2. Pat the salmon fillets dry with a paper towel. Place the fillets in a big bowl.
  3. In a small bowl, mix together the olive oil, lemon juice, minced garlic, thyme, rosemary and salt.
  4. Add the mixture over the salmon fillets.
  5. Marinate salmon to for about 20 minutes or longer.
  6. Place the fillets on a baking sheet and bake them for about 15 minutes, or until the salmon flakes easily with a fork.
  7. Transfer the fillets to serving plates and serve the bake salmon with your favourite side dishes, such as onion, roasted vegetables or a fresh green salad.

Notes

  • Cooking time may vary depending on the oven and thickness of the fillets.
  • Marination can take longer time than given.
